This coin is a mystery. It was a mystery to the seller and now it is my mystery. I am hoping someone can recognize it. It seems to have a lion left, head facing, and Arabic (is that the right language?) on the obverse. The reverse seems to be Arabic in the field, however from 6:00 it may read MEILEEXXCASH ... around the outside. I could well have some of those letters wrong. I have googled parts of that legend combined with "lion" and "Arabic" or "CASH" etc. and come up with nothing. Might the obverse be dated below the lion? 1025? AH? 1825? -- which can't be an AH date.
